Washington Monthly magazine has rated the University of Michigan as the 12th best university in the nation. The magazine ranked Michigan State University number 30.
The magazine noted that the ranking were based on the school's contribution to the public good in three broad categories: Social Mobility (recruiting and graduating low-income students), Research (producing cutting-edge scholarship and PhDs), and Service (encouraging students to give something back to their country). -- A.L.
